Q: Is 12,635,425 a Composite Number?

 A: Yes, 12,635,425 is a composite number.

Why is 12,635,425 a composite number?

A composite number is a number that can be divided evenly by more numbers than 1 and itself. It is the opposite of a prime number.

The number 12,635,425 can be evenly divided by 1 5 11 25 55 121 275 605 3,025 4,177 20,885 45,947 104,425 229,735 505,417 1,148,675 2,527,085 and 12,635,425, with no remainder.

Since 12,635,425 cannot be divided by just 1 and 12,635,425, it is a composite number.
